Police Chief Shon Barnes could be out in wake of Seattle Center shooting


Seattle Mayor Katie Wilson reportedly relieved embattled Police Chief Shon Barnes of his duties Wednesday night following mounting criticism over his absence from the city and the department’s delayed public response to a mass shooting, a run-in with a reporter and questions over his frequently being out of the city.Barnes was asked to resign during a meeting with the democratic socialist Wilson after he abruptly left a silent vigil for the victims of Sunday’s Bite of Seattle shooting, five sources told FOX 13 Seattle.It is unclear if Barnes accepted Wilson's call for resignation or was ultimately fired.Barnes had canceled a series of scheduled interviews earlier Wednesday and later began texting people about his dismissal, according to the report. The mayor’s office and Seattle Police Department had not publicly confirmed the change or announced who would lead the department next.SEATTLE POLICE CHIEF SNAPS OVER CHICAGO HOME QUESTIONS, ABSENCE FROM CITY AFTER MASS SHOOTINGBarnes was feeling the heat from the media for his alleged frequent weekend absences, reportedly due to the fact he is originally from Chicago, where his family still resides."Those reports are wrong, do you understand?" Barnes told a reporter during a tense exchange earlier in the week.A staffer stepped between Barnes and the reporter as the chief defended his commitment to the city.The confrontation followed criticism of Barnes’ absence when gunfire erupted Sunday evening outside the Seattle Center Armory during the Bite of Seattle festival.
